Laura Klünder
86de9dd053
enable overwriting wrapped qs cache to avoid _get_created_objects again
2017-06-18 06:17:46 +02:00
Laura Klünder
b773373d73
use space.pk instead of space.id so everything works wrapped
2017-06-18 05:58:24 +02:00
Laura Klünder
376a6fddbf
cannot break here, this means only adding one property
2017-06-18 05:32:12 +02:00
Laura Klünder
604f8c3be5
fix redirects with noscript
2017-06-18 05:17:41 +02:00
Laura Klünder
07c6c11373
redirectslug unique check and QuerySetWrapper.delete()
2017-06-18 05:14:02 +02:00
Laura Klünder
bc1b96e43f
move noscript note
2017-06-18 04:42:49 +02:00
Laura Klünder
93c33ce605
filtering==, validate_unique and created model inheritance
2017-06-18 04:40:37 +02:00
Laura Klünder
2611e20284
values_list should be iterable multiple times
2017-06-18 01:19:41 +02:00
Laura Klünder
b0557a5d58
dont zoom out when starting to edit something
2017-06-18 01:12:38 +02:00
Laura Klünder
a60d2ba36c
dont zoom map on space or level edit
2017-06-18 01:08:04 +02:00
Laura Klünder
0be9100c0f
use is_created_pk everywhere
2017-06-18 01:04:07 +02:00
Laura Klünder
27af4d0dc5
remove unneeded code for manager.core_filters that slowed everything down
2017-06-18 00:50:50 +02:00
Laura Klünder
df880ca43b
always get queryset on manager (for filtering)
2017-06-18 00:45:06 +02:00
Laura Klünder
fb9479783f
return created objects in values_list
2017-06-18 00:00:29 +02:00
Laura Klünder
56284038c2
correct treatment of core_filters in Wrappers
2017-06-17 23:59:55 +02:00
Laura Klünder
bd32896b95
fix get_color()
2017-06-17 23:40:23 +02:00
Laura Klünder
036a8bf607
update _parse_change to avoid glitches
2017-06-17 23:37:43 +02:00
Laura Klünder
4e5f3b952e
update Change.__repr__ so it does also work on deleted objects
2017-06-17 23:23:32 +02:00
Laura Klünder
c3fd098f05
fix Wrapped Queryset none()
2017-06-17 23:12:23 +02:00
Laura Klünder
44811460a1
fix prefetch_related about existing objects
2017-06-17 22:50:56 +02:00
Laura Klünder
2cb66cbd64
remove debug call that caused duplicate results
2017-06-17 22:45:44 +02:00
Laura Klünder
94b080c58d
remove debug output
2017-06-17 22:20:03 +02:00
Laura Klünder
1c5a786dca
get_prefetch_queryset and _apply_rel_filters
2017-06-17 22:18:18 +02:00
Laura Klünder
4325b1984d
raise error if there is unsupported extrastuff
2017-06-17 22:13:43 +02:00
Laura Klünder
ec18984875
fix m2m prefetch_related with newly created objects
2017-06-17 22:11:20 +02:00
Laura Klünder
f0d4d122da
fix changeset parsing on prefetch_related with manytomany
2017-06-17 21:50:15 +02:00
Laura Klünder
cb4867614c
fix reverse m2m __in filter
2017-06-17 20:05:33 +02:00
Laura Klünder
e7292692d5
add QuerySetWrapper support for reverse m2m __in filtering
2017-06-17 19:42:17 +02:00
Laura Klünder
1fb37eb41b
temporarily disable prefetch_reload('groups')
2017-06-16 22:27:10 +02:00
Laura Klünder
f4700cc392
call to_python on updated values from the db
2017-06-16 22:22:34 +02:00
Laura Klünder
5b07e22b93
remove debug output
2017-06-16 21:03:33 +02:00
Laura Klünder
60551ff9b0
added existing m2ms were not correctly parsed
2017-06-16 20:47:06 +02:00
Laura Klünder
1d6ce7179d
add simple api to view the current changeset
2017-06-16 20:27:07 +02:00
Laura Klünder
7bad785155
remove wrap_instances flag
2017-06-16 19:37:51 +02:00
Laura Klünder
0b38921b94
fix manytomany queries
2017-06-16 19:19:54 +02:00
Laura Klünder
66d91e071f
fix get_color() lookup also in space geometry view
2017-06-16 18:45:34 +02:00
Laura Klünder
9eb832b048
ManyToMany Managers should also look into prefetch cache
2017-06-16 18:42:54 +02:00
Laura Klünder
edfb083c61
fix get_color() on ModelInstanceWrapper
2017-06-16 18:38:41 +02:00
Laura Klünder
8fef2a81a9
reimplement wrapped prefetch_related
2017-06-16 18:19:52 +02:00
Laura Klünder
19856dfd8a
add created object to querysets (not yet fully working with select_related)
2017-06-16 16:34:27 +02:00
Laura Klünder
1d9564568b
use get_prep_value / to_python before serializing changed values
2017-06-16 13:08:26 +02:00
Laura Klünder
410398b21e
title_de support in get_created_object
2017-06-16 13:08:14 +02:00
Laura Klünder
0d67c2d1d8
ChangeSet.get_created_object()
2017-06-16 13:00:59 +02:00
Laura Klünder
bfabae222a
dont double-parse value
2017-06-16 12:22:44 +02:00
Laura Klünder
1596be0a87
fix parsing create-changes
2017-06-16 12:22:36 +02:00
Laura Klünder
109174b1ba
better exception message
2017-06-16 12:07:18 +02:00
Laura Klünder
696c26cd70
add RelatedManagerWrapper.create
2017-06-16 12:06:52 +02:00
Laura Klünder
3081b4b9c8
sticky form buttons also in creation forms
2017-06-16 11:56:24 +02:00
Laura Klünder
9ba14677c0
Revert commits about evaluating the queryset at the end.
...
This reverts commit a0a17c3630985fe960211708f5b90acf449f76b3.
This reverts commit 92122270e5815cbbf301a6e247c682a05717b19d.
This reverts commit c5d4c4d347e99be00258d55ec6338e3749084bbe.
This reverts commit c78876087d29511b6126132a213f4267249a869f.
2017-06-16 11:50:24 +02:00
Laura Klünder
e187e1ef67
when queueing a filter command cast iterables of __in values to tuples
2017-06-16 10:15:28 +02:00